Depending on your major, there are certain requirements that must be met before you can enroll in many internship courses within the College of Engineering & Technology. These prerequisites are separated by department and can be found below.

Architecture & Engineering Design (Drafting, Surveying, & Mapping)

EGDT 2810R

  • Completion of EGDT 1010, EGDT 1040, EGDT 1070 or 1071, EGDT 1020, EGDT 1100, EGDT 1200, EGDT 1300, and EGDT 1400 all with a grade of C- or higher.

Please be aware that EGDT students cannot register for an internship course after mid-semester.

SURV 4810R

  • Junior or Senior standing
  • Matriculation into the Geomatics BS degree
  • University Advanced Standing: This requires completing, and/or transferring in, at least 24 credits of college-level coursework (1000 or higher). Having a cumulative GPA of 2.0 or higher. Complete MAT 1030 or higher and ENGL 2010, 2020 or equivalent
